Total Nonstop Action and Ring Of Honor will be head-to-head on cable TV this Thursday, March 13th, at 9pm. TNA Impact! will air on Spike TV. At the same time, ROH "Rising Above" will play on pay-per-view on iN DEMAND. "Rising Above" will also be available on The DISH Network's All Day Ticket on Thursday.

The complete lineup for ROH "Rising Above" on pay-per-view featuring metal favorite "Raining Blood" by Slayer has:
 
ROH World Title Match
Nigel McGuinness vs. Austin Aries
 
ROH World Tag Team Title 2/3 Falls Match
Jay & Mark Briscoe vs. Rocky Romero & Roderick Strong
 
Relaxed Rules
Bryan Danielson vs. Takeshi Morishima
 
Grudge Match #1
Claudio Castagnoli vs. Chris Hero with Larry Sweeney
 
Grudge Match #2
Erick Stevens vs. Davey Richards
 
Grudge Match #3
Delirious vs. Brent Albright
 
Tag Team Scramble
Jimmy Jacobs & Tyler Black vs. Kevin Steen & El Generico vs. Jack Evans & Ruckus vs. Adam Pearce & BJ Whitmer
 
Three-Way Women's Match
Sara Del Rey vs. Lacey vs. Daizee Haze
